Megaskepasma erythrochlamys Family: Acanthaceae Brazilian Plume, Brazilian Red Cloak Origin: Central America 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() The Brazilian Red Cloak is a very showy shrub. It is fast growing and blooms during the winter. Use mulch to keep the soil moist. The red cloak is occasionally attacked by mealy bugs and scales. Check for them. Deadheading the spent flower branches helps controlling the size and keep the red cloak cleaner looking. Feed occasionally with fertilizer for acid-loving plants. |
